The free version only supports certain vehicles, models etc. See http://www.multiecuscan.net/SupportedVehiclesList.aspx

The free version is perfectly functional on SUPPORTED models. For other models it goes into a 20 minute simulation mode where potential users/purchasers can view and examine what will be available in a purchased edition/license.
